Escape window installation services involve replacing or adding windows that are designed to meet specific safety and emergency escape requirements. These windows are typically installed in bedrooms, basements, or other living spaces where quick and easy exit might be necessary during an emergency. The process includes removing old windows, preparing the opening to ensure a secure fit, and installing new escape windows that meet safety standards. This service helps homeowners enhance the safety of their properties by ensuring that all bedrooms and living areas have accessible escape routes in case of fire or other emergencies.

The overview below groups typical Escape Window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Tucker, GA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window adjustments or replacing a single glass pane generally range from $100 to $300. Many routine repairs fall within this band, depending on the window size and complexity.
Standard Installations - Replacing or installing standard-sized escape windows usually costs between $250 and $600. Most projects in Tucker, GA, land in this range, with fewer jobs reaching higher prices for additional features.
Full Replacement - Larger, more involved window replacements can range from $800 to $2,500, especially for custom sizes or upgraded materials. These projects tend to be less common but are necessary for older or severely damaged windows.
Complex or Custom Projects - Highly customized or multi-window installations may cost $3,000 or more, depending on the scope and complexity. Such projects are less frequent but handled by local contractors for larger homes or commercial properties.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are escape window installation services? Escape window installation involves fitting specially designed windows that provide emergency exits in basements or other rooms, enhancing safety and accessibility.
Who can handle escape window installation? Local contractors experienced in window installation and safety code compliance can perform escape window installation for residential properties.
What should I consider when choosing an escape window? Factors include the window size, egress requirements, and the type of window that best fits the space and safety standards.
Are there different types of escape windows? Yes, options include casement, awning, and sliding windows, each suited for different space and aesthetic considerations.
